Motorized active assisted joint motion devices combine powered assistance with patient-driven effort to rebuild strength, restore range of motion and support neuromuscular reeducation. In the UK these systems are increasingly used in sports rehabilitation clinics, outpatient physiotherapy and private practice because they deliver consistent, programmable therapy that accelerates functional recovery while recording objective progress. Consumers and clinicians prefer them for their customizable assistance levels, integrated biofeedback and patient engagement features, which reduce therapist workload, improve adherence and help return athletes and patients to daily activities faster. Cost, portability, clinical evidence and compatibility with existing NHS and private clinic pathways are key factors shaping purchasing decisions across the market.

What the Research Says About Motorized Active Assisted Therapy
Scientific research, including randomized controlled trials, systematic reviews and clinical cohort studies, supports the benefits of active assisted, motorized devices for improving range of motion, increasing muscle activation and enhancing functional outcomes compared with passive-only approaches. Studies emphasise early controlled active movement and neuromuscular retraining as important for reducing stiffness, preserving joint health and promoting motor relearning after injury or surgery. Evidence also highlights the value of objective metrics and adjustable assistance in personalising rehabilitation and tracking progress.
Clinical outcomes: Trials and clinical studies report faster gains in range of motion and improved patient-reported function when active assisted protocols are used versus passive-only interventions.
Neuromuscular benefits: Assisted active movement supports motor relearning and coordinated muscle activation, which is vital for returning to sport and daily function after injury.
Functional recovery: Devices that allow graduated resistance and patient-driven effort tend to produce better functional measures, such as walking speed or task performance, compared with passive modalities.
Engagement and adherence: Integrated biofeedback, gamification and real-time metrics increase patient motivation and therapy adherence, which are linked to better outcomes.
Safety and protocols: Research highlights the importance of clinician-led settings, individualised progression and monitoring to avoid overloading healing tissues; many studies support early but controlled mobilisation under supervision.
Limitations and ongoing research: While results are positive, more large-scale comparative trials are still needed on long-term outcomes and cost effectiveness in different UK care settings.
